static char *udesc = "Use the RealTime config handler system to update a value\n"
"RealTimeUpdate(<family>|<colmatch>|<value>|<newcol>|<newval>)\n\n"
"The column <newcol> in 'family' matching column <colmatch>=<value> will be updated to <newval>\n";

static int realtime_update_exec(struct ast_channel *chan, void *data) {
char *family=NULL, *colmatch=NULL, *value=NULL, *newcol=NULL, *newval=NULL;
struct localuser *u;
int res = 0;
if (!data) {
ast_log(LOG_ERROR,"Invalid input %s\n",UUSAGE);
return -1;
}
LOCAL_USER_ADD(u);
if ((family = ast_strdupa(data))) {
if ((colmatch = strchr(family,'|'))) {
crop_data(colmatch);
if ((value = strchr(colmatch,'|'))) {
crop_data(value);
if ((newcol = strchr(value,'|'))) {
crop_data(newcol);
if ((newval = strchr(newcol,'|')))
crop_data(newval);
}
}
}
}
if (! (family && value && colmatch && newcol && newval) ) {
ast_log(LOG_ERROR,"Invalid input: usage %s\n",UUSAGE);
res = -1;
} else {
ast_update_realtime(family,colmatch,value,newcol,newval,NULL);
}
LOCAL_USER_REMOVE(u);
return res;
}
